Occupational choice and the dynamics of human capital, inequality and growth
Dvorkin, Maximiliano A.; Monge-Naranjo, Alexander - 2019
We construct a dynamic general equilibrium model with occupation mobility, human capital accumulation and endogenous assignment of workers to tasks to quantitatively assess the aggregate impact of automation and other task-biased technological innovations. We extend recent quantitative general...
